The origin of clothing dates back to the history of the early men who then made clothes from leaves, strings (all from plants) and hides and skin from animals they killed. Further improvements, however took place as there were modifications as the year went by. Although modern consumers take clothing for granted making the fabrics that go into clothing not easy. One sign of this is that the textile industry was the first to be merchandised during the industrial revolution, before the invention of the powered loom, textile production was tedious and labour intensive process. Materials were sourced from plants, animals etc and molded into finished products known as fabrics which are today worn by all.
